For instance, the cost of for a uPVC front door can be lower than a composite or wooden door. This is because the uPVC door has an inert layer on the outside that gives it durability and insulation. The inside of the door is made of an insulating, multi-chamber interior.

uPVC is also more affordable because it does not require staining or painting. While a timber or composite door would need to be painted every few years, it is not necessary for a uPVC door can be maintained without a lot of maintenance.

A uPVC front door will save you money on your energy bills. It will keep your heating in the right spot, instead of letting it escape through the front door. uPVC is also low in carbon footprint.

The price of a upvc replacement door panel front door is going to vary depending on the type, colour, and glazing. Before you decide to buy a upvc door panel with cat flap door, it is important to understand how to compare prices.

Some factors to consider include the design and dimensions of the door and the amount of glass needed, and the labour required to set up the door. The price of the door could also be dependent on the location of your home. Before replacing your front door, it's crucial to get a written quote.

A professional should be hired to install the uPVC door front for your home. Professional installation will guarantee that the door meets building trade standards. This will avoid future headaches.

Lastly, uPVC doors are not as robust as composite or wood doors. Based on the quality of the product and how well it is installed and maintained, a uPVC front door can last for between 10 and 30 years.
